Raymond OLIVER Obituary

STERLING - Raymond Eugene Oliver Jr., age 57, of Sterling, Va., passed away peacefully on Wednesday, Aug. 4, 2010. He had bravely battled bone cancer (osteosarcoma) for five years.
Ray is survived by his loving wife of 36 years, Susan Lord Oliver; and his children, Karen Oliver of Ashburn, Va., and Jason Oliver and his wife, Meggan of Penticton, British Columbia. He is also survived by his parents, Raymond and Frances Oliver of Newport News, Va., his brother, Bill Oliver; and his sister, Cynthia Oliver Butler. Additionally, he leaves behind many other dear relatives and friends.
Ray was born on May 22, 1953, in Alleghany County, Va. He graduated from Warwick High School in 1971, Lynchburg College in 1975 with a BS in Economics, and did graduate work at Georgetown University in International Economics. Professionally, he worked at many consulting firms in the D.C. area, primarily in the Human Resources field. He believed strongly in volunteerism, and used his financial expertise to serve in many capacities.
He was a 30-year member of Sterling United Methodist Church, where he served as treasurer for many years. He was a founding board member and treasurer of the Teri and Shari Malone Foundation (honoring talented 8th grade students in Loudoun County). He volunteered with the county extension service, giving financial advice. He particularly enjoyed the "Reality Store" program, helping high school seniors understand the budgeting process. He also served as an Election Precinct Chief for the state of Virginia and on many other church and neighborhood committees through the years.
